Lines Matching defs:vub300_mmc_host
296 struct vub300_mmc_host {
355 #define kref_to_vub300_mmc_host(d) container_of(d, struct vub300_mmc_host, kref)
371 struct vub300_mmc_host *vub300 = kref_to_vub300_mmc_host(kref);
385 static void vub300_queue_cmnd_work(struct vub300_mmc_host *vub300)
405 static void vub300_queue_poll_work(struct vub300_mmc_host *vub300, int delay)
425 static void vub300_queue_dead_work(struct vub300_mmc_host *vub300)
447 struct vub300_mmc_host *vub300 = (struct vub300_mmc_host *)urb->context;
455 struct vub300_mmc_host *vub300 = (struct vub300_mmc_host *)urb->context;
477 static void send_irqpoll(struct vub300_mmc_host *vub300)
503 static void new_system_port_status(struct vub300_mmc_host *vub300)
529 static void __add_offloaded_reg_to_fifo(struct vub300_mmc_host *vub300,
540 static void add_offloaded_reg(struct vub300_mmc_host *vub300,
567 static void check_vub300_port_status(struct vub300_mmc_host *vub300)
584 static void __vub300_irqpoll_response(struct vub300_mmc_host *vub300)
654 static void __do_poll(struct vub300_mmc_host *vub300)
679 struct vub300_mmc_host *vub300 = container_of(work,
680 struct vub300_mmc_host, pollwork.work);
710 struct vub300_mmc_host *vub300 =
711 container_of(work, struct vub300_mmc_host, deadwork);
743 struct vub300_mmc_host *vub300 = from_timer(vub300, t,
793 struct vub300_mmc_host *vub300 = (struct vub300_mmc_host *)urb->context;
822 struct vub300_mmc_host *vub300 = (struct vub300_mmc_host *)urb->context;
852 static void snoop_block_size_and_bus_width(struct vub300_mmc_host *vub300,
889 static void send_command(struct vub300_mmc_host *vub300)
1183 struct vub300_mmc_host *vub300 = from_timer(vub300, t,
1199 static void __download_offload_pseudocode(struct vub300_mmc_host *vub300,
1355 static void download_offload_pseudocode(struct vub300_mmc_host *vub300)
1397 static int vub300_usb_bulk_msg(struct vub300_mmc_host *vub300,
1430 static int __command_read_data(struct vub300_mmc_host *vub300,
1502 static int __command_write_data(struct vub300_mmc_host *vub300,
1590 static void __vub300_command_response(struct vub300_mmc_host *vub300,
1710 static void construct_request_response(struct vub300_mmc_host *vub300,
1744 struct vub300_mmc_host *vub300 =
1745 container_of(work, struct vub300_mmc_host, cmndwork);
1797 static int examine_cyclic_buffer(struct vub300_mmc_host *vub300,
1854 static int satisfy_request_from_offloaded_data(struct vub300_mmc_host *vub300,
1904 struct vub300_mmc_host *vub300 = mmc_priv(mmc);
1967 static void __set_clock_speed(struct vub300_mmc_host *vub300, u8 buf[8],
2009 struct vub300_mmc_host *vub300 = mmc_priv(mmc);
2044 struct vub300_mmc_host *vub300 = mmc_priv(mmc);
2050 struct vub300_mmc_host *vub300 = mmc_priv(mmc);
2088 struct vub300_mmc_host *vub300;
2119 mmc = mmc_alloc_host(sizeof(struct vub300_mmc_host), &udev->dev);
2362 struct vub300_mmc_host *vub300 = usb_get_intfdata(interface);
2399 struct vub300_mmc_host *vub300 = usb_get_intfdata(intf);
2406 struct vub300_mmc_host *vub300 = usb_get_intfdata(intf);